Politicians and football supporters groups have united in calling for the Football League to make public who owns its clubs after the league approved as "fit and proper" the offshore owners of Leeds United while keeping their identity private.
Does this issue raise any alarms over the ownership of your own club? Here are five questions you should be able to answer. Please let us know your thoughts below the line:
1 Do you know who the individual people are who own your club? At most clubs in the Premier League and Football League, this is clear, but at some, like Leeds, it is still not.
2 Do you know clearly what their motivations are, and do they have sustainable plans for the club? Are they supporters who want to contribute to the club's health and future, and if they have other motives, have they clearly explained them?
3 Do you know what structures they are using. For example, are they using offshore tax havens to hold the shares in English football clubs? Are they holding the shares in such a way as to enable them to avoid paying UK tax when they finally sell the club?
4 Do you know whether they have put money into the club for them to invest, and if so in what way?
5 Do you know whether they have been paid money out of the club in salaries, dividends, interest on loans, or made money from the sale of shares, and if so how much?
